Clients in order to aware that different rules apply when the IRS has already placed a tax lien against them. A bankruptcy may relieve you of personal liability on the tax debt, but in many circumstances will not discharge a suitably filed tax lien. After bankruptcy, the government cannot chase you personally for the debt, however the lien will remain on any assets as well as will stop able provide these assets without satisfying the outstanding lien. - this includes your homes. Depending upon the lien also using the filed, could be be other available choices to attack the validity of the lien.
